Biographical FAQ

Who was Alpheus Spring Packard?

Alpheus Spring Packard was a prominent 19th-century entomologist and scientific illustrator. Born in 1839, he devoted his life to the study of insects and the documentation of North America's subterranean fauna. His work was widely published and respected in the field of biology, earning him a distinguished place among the naturalists of his time. Packard also taught at Brown University, influencing many biology students.

Are there any interesting anecdotes about Packard?

An interesting anecdote about Packard is his role in founding the American Naturalist, an influential scientific journal he co-founded in 1867. This publication played a crucial role in spreading the scientific ideas of the time, especially those related to evolution and biology. Packard was also known for his passion for teaching, sharing his knowledge enthusiastically and inspiring many students to pursue careers in natural sciences.

Artistic Journey

Education and Beginnings

Alpheus Spring Packard began his natural sciences education at Harvard University, where he studied under Louis Agassiz, a prominent naturalist. This experience profoundly influenced his career, providing him with a solid foundation in biology and scientific illustration. After his studies, Packard quickly began publishing his own research, building a reputation in entomology.

Key Period

The key period of Packard’s career was marked by his work on subterranean fauna. In the 1870s, he undertook a series of expeditions to explore North American caves, documenting the life he found there. These studies culminated in the publication of "The Fauna of North American Caves," a work that solidified his reputation as a pioneer of scientific illustration.
